What is the cheapest month to fly from London to Lima?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from London to Lima,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from London to Lima is February, where tickets cost £617 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and August,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is £1,187 and £932 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from London to Lima?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from London to Lima,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from London to Lima, you should book around 4 weeks before departure, which saves you about 8%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 21 weeks before departure.

  • What are some retail options at Lima Airport (LIM)?

    If you enjoy airport shopping, then you’re sure to love shopping at Lima Airport because all the shops are open 24h a day for your retail pleasure. Britt Shop specialises in Peruvian handicrafts and gourmet foods, which make fantastic gift ideas, and be sure to stop by Lima Duty Free for all your tax-free shopping needs.

  • Are there places to relax at Lima Airport?

    Passengers looking to unwind after the long flight from London to Lima will certainly enjoy the professionals at Express Massage and their soothing massage chairs, but if you need something more comprehensive, pay a visit to SPA Express, where a massage, manicure and/or pedicure will leave you feeling rejuvenated.

  • Is there a chemist at Lima Airport?

    Long haul flights can often leave you with an assortment of aches and pains, and if you happen to be suffering from one of them, then you may wish to visit The Travel Market, which is a chemist located on the second floor of the terminal building, and purchase some over-the-counter medicine to get you back on your feet.

  • Where can I purchase some Nuevo sol at Lima Airport?

    Nuevo sol is the local Peruvian currency that you’ll need once you land at Lima Airport. There are several places where you can sell some Pound sterling for Nuevo sol, including World Xchange, which operates a currency exchange bureau, while Interbank offers a wider range of banking services from two locations. There are also ATMs operated by several banks, including BBVA and BCP if you prefer.

  • What options are there for hotels at Lima Airport?

    As it’s a long flight from London to Lima, you might want to stay at a hotel upon arrival, before continuing your onward journey. You can stay at Wyndham Costa del Sol Lima Airport, which has a 24/7 reception, so you can arrive at any time.

  • Which other cities does Lima Airport serve?

    When you land at Lima Airport, you’ll be able to reach a range of nearby locations with ease. For example, you can drive to Ventanilla in about 30 minutes, Carabayllo in around 50min and Canta in approximately 2h 30min.

KAYAK’s top tips for finding a cheap flight from London to Lima

  • Due to the length of the flight from London to Lima, it makes good sense to consider spending the night at an airport hotel, especially if you have an early morning departure. If you are using London Heathrow Airport (LHR), you should know that there are two full-service hotels on the airport premises: Sofitel London Heathrow Airport at Terminal 5 and Hilton London Heathrow Airport at Terminal 4.
  • Passengers departing from London Gatwick Airport (LGW) who are travelling with children can rest easy knowing that there are four designated baby changing facilities, including at the check-in area, and there are also Kid Zones in both North and South Terminals to occupy the young ones while you wait for your flight to be called.
  • Entrepreneurs and corporate travellers on flights from London to Lima using London Heathrow Airport should enjoy the ambience of meeting rooms offering the full range of office capabilities to ensure your presentations are complete. There is a Regus Business Lounge in each of Terminal 2, 3 and 5, while Plaza Premium operates the lounge at Terminal 4.
  • If you’re flying out of London Gatwick Airport, you should be aware that the North and South Terminals are separated by an area of just over 0.6 mi and it is necessary to take the inter-terminal shuttle service to travel from one to the other, so add to some extra travel time to your itinerary just in case.
  • Passengers at Heathrow Airport in need of assistance should look out for one of the Passenger Ambassadors in their distinctive purple blazers whose job it is to help you navigate your way around and provide helpful information so you can make the most of the facilities and services the airport has to offer.
  • You can get flights from several of London’s airports to Lima Airport (LIM), making it very convenient to travel from the capital city. If you’re based in the centre of the city, both Heathrow Airport (LHR) and London City Airport (LCY) are good options. For those that live to the north of London, Stansted Airport (STN) and Luton Airport (LTN) are great options. Meanwhile, those to the south of London will most likely find Gatwick Airport (LGW) easy to reach.
  • You won’t normally need a visa to travel to Peru from the UK, provided you are only visiting for tourism reasons. However, you should apply online for a special permit with allows you to explain your purpose of visiting. Upon arrival at Lima Airport, you will normally be permitted to stay for up to 90 days. For stays longer than this, you should contact the Peruvian Consulate in London before you travel.
